Nature of request
John and Margaret de Sutton request the restoration of the manor of Bradfield, which they held by right of Margaret until they were disseised by Hugh le Despenser. The manor is now in the king's hands on the death of Despenser.
Nature of endorsement
Assign in Chancery people to enquire in the presence of the keeper of the manor concerning this disseisin, when, and by whom, and all other necessary circumstances touching this matter, and return the inquisition into Chancery to who the king.
Places mentioned
Bradfield, Berkshire.
People mentioned
Hugh le Despenser.
Note
Commissions of enquiry were issued into this matter in February and March 1327 (CIM 1307-49, pp.239-40), and orders to restore the petitioners were issued on 12 April 1327. Presumably presented to the parliament of January-March 1327.
